Output 65b529cb3938646d13ec01fcd86c3674a29d7c4856e1421634d736b235e333e3:0

value
94646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23b66ad705c8e522780845e31d0442c64d6a25e2 OP_EQUAL
address
34wr6qW51FpBhMSw7cGZN4R1fieWz4UZta
transaction
65b529cb3938646d13ec01fcd86c3674a29d7c4856e1421634d736b235e333e3
spent
true